Our team is running way behind on this event. Can anyone advise what kind of motor they are running? What voltage would you suggest. A three blade or a 2 blade prop? I know I'm asking for details, but I'm sure it takes a lot of time and trial to get this to work. Just looking for a starting point..thanks

Baker,
Start with some planning. Any small commercial motor should work. Plan out your sled so it's well balanced. Number of prop blades isn't extremely important. I slapped together a maglev in 5 hours and got top six at regionals with a two blade prop. Best of luck!
